What is meningitis and Why It Needs Attention?
Meningitis is essentially an infection causing inflammation of the meninges, the protective membranes covering the brain and spinal cord. This inflammation can disrupt normal brain function. Common Causes of meningitis
The most frequent primary cause of meningitis: Bacterial infections are a leading culprit, with common bacteria like Streptococcus pneumoniae and Neisseria meningitidis often responsible.
The most common secondary cause of meningitis: Viral infections, though generally less severe than bacterial meningitis, are also a significant cause, with enteroviruses being particularly prevalent.

Symptoms of meningitis That Need Medical Attention
The most concerning symptom of meningitis: A stiff neck accompanied by a severe headache and fever is a classic warning sign that should never be ignored.
A symptom indicating the condition is worsening: Sensitivity to light (photophobia) and confusion or altered mental state signal a progression of the infection and require urgent intervention.
A symptom that requires immediate medical help: Seizures, rash that doesn’t fade when pressed (petechial rash), and difficulty breathing are critical emergencies demanding immediate hospitalisation.
Diagnosing meningitis and When to Seek Medical Help
Diagnosing meningitis involves a thorough medical history and physical examination by a qualified doctor. The doctor will assess symptoms such as fever, headache, and neck stiffness. To confirm the diagnosis, a lumbar puncture (spinal tap) is often performed to collect c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) for analysis. This analysis helps identify the specific cause of the infection, whether it's bacterial, viral, or fungal. Blood tests may also be conducted. meningitis Treatments and Remedies
Medical treatments: Bacterial meningitis requires immediate treatment with intravenous antibiotics to combat the infection. The specific antibiotic will depend on the type of bacteria identified. In some cases, corticosteroids may also be administered to reduce inflammation and improve outcomes. Viral meningitis is often milder and may resolve on its own with supportive care. Antiviral medications are sometimes used for specific viral infections. Symptom management includes pain relief with analgesics and fever reduction with antipyretics. Hospitalisation is usually necessary for close monitoring and supportive care.
Home remedies: While home remedies cannot cure meningitis, they can provide comfort and support recovery alongside medical treatment. Rest is crucial to allow the body to heal. Ensuring adequate hydration by drinking plenty of fluids, such as water and electrolyte solutions, is also important. A light, easily digestible diet can help prevent nausea and vomiting. A cool, dark room can help alleviate light sensitivity.
Lifestyle changes: Prevention is key to reducing the risk of meningitis. Practising good hygiene, such as frequent handwashing with soap and water, is essential. Avoid close contact with individuals who are sick. Ensure that vaccinations are up-to-date, as vaccines are available for some types of bacterial meningitis. Maintaining a healthy lifestyle, including a balanced diet, regular exercise, and sufficient sleep, can strengthen the immune system and reduce susceptibility to infections.
